Simple Stretches to Improve Circulation

  • Ankle Circles: Sit comfortably with your feet flat on the floor. Lift one foot off the ground and draw circles with your ankle, starting from small circles and gradually increasing in size. Repeat for 5-10 repetitions on each foot. Toe Wiggles: Sit or stand with your feet flat on the floor. Wiggle your toes back and forth, then from side to side. Repeat for 5-10 repetitions. Calf Raises: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art. Slowly raise up onto your tiptoes, then lower back down. Repeat for 10-15 repetitions. * Seated Leg Stretch: Sit comfortably with your feet flat on the floor. Slowly lift one leg out to the side, keeping your knee straight.

    The Benefits of Seated Leg Extensions and Seated Leg Curls

    Seated leg extensions and seated leg curls are two exercises that can be performed in a seated position, targeting different muscle groups in the legs. These exercises are beneficial for overall leg development, circulation, and even back pain relief.

    Why Choose Seated Leg Extensions? Seated leg extensions are an effective exercise for strengthening the quadriceps muscles. The quadriceps are the muscles on the front of the thigh, responsible for straightening the knee and extending the leg. Strengthening these muscles can help improve balance, stability, and overall athletic performance. Key benefits of seated leg extensions:

      • Targets the quadriceps muscles
      • Improves balance and stability
      • Enhances athletic performance
      • Can help alleviate knee pain
      • Why Choose Seated Leg Curls? Seated leg curls target the hamstrings, which are the muscles on the back of the thigh. The hamstrings play a crucial role in hip flexion and knee flexion. Strengthening these muscles can help alleviate back pain, improve posture, and enhance overall lower body strength.

        Hamstring Stretching: A Simple yet Effective Exercise

        Stretching the hamstrings is a simple yet effective exercise that can be done anywhere, at any time. It’s a great way to alleviate tightness and improve flexibility in the legs, enhancing blood flow to the muscles. In this article, we’ll explore the benefits of hamstring stretching and provide a step-by-step guide on how to do it.

        Benefits of Hamstring Stretching

      • Improves flexibility and range of motion
      • Reduces muscle soreness and stiffness
      • Enhances blood flow to the muscles
      • Can help prevent injuries and improve athletic performance
      • How to Stretch Your Hamstrings

        To stretch your hamstrings, follow these steps:

      • Stand with your feet hip-width apart. Bend at the hips and reach toward your toes while keeping your knees slightly bent. Hold the stretch for 20-30 seconds.

      • The Benefits of Improved Circulation

        Improved circulation can have numerous benefits for your overall health and well-being. Some of the benefits include:

      • Reduced Swelling: Improved circulation can help reduce swelling in the legs and feet. Increased Energy: Better circulation can increase oxygen delivery to your muscles, leading to increased energy levels. Improved Mental Clarity: Improved circulation can also improve blood flow to the brain, leading to improved mental clarity and focus. ## Additional Tips for Improving Circulation**
      • Additional Tips for Improving Circulation

        In addition to incorporating simple stretches and exercises into your routine, there are several other tips you can follow to improve circulation:

      • Stay Hydrated: Drinking plenty of water can help improve circulation by thinning out blood and reducing blood pressure. Exercise Regularly: Regular exercise can help improve circulation by increasing blood flow and reducing blood pressure. Avoid Smoking: Smoking can constrict blood vessels and reduce circulation, so quitting can help improve circulation.

        What is Blood Circulation? Before we dive into the exercises, let’s take a quick look at what blood circulation is and why it’s so important for our back health. Blood circulation refers to the flow of blood through our veins and arteries, delivering oxygen and nutrients to our cells and organs. In the back, poor circulation can lead to stiffness, pain, and inflammation, making everyday activities a chore. ## Why Exercise is Key

        Exercise is a powerful tool for improving blood circulation in the back. When we move our bodies, we stimulate the muscles and joints, which in turn stimulate the blood vessels to dilate and improve circulation. This can help to reduce stiffness, pain, and inflammation, making it easier to move and perform daily activities.

        Exercises to Increase Blood Circulation in Your Back

        Here are some simple exercises you can do to increase blood circulation in your back:

      • Knee to Chest Stretch: Lie on your back and bring one knee towards your chest. Hold for 30 seconds and repeat on the other side. * Cat-Cow Stretch: Start on your hands and knees. Arch your back, lifting your tailbone and head towards the ceiling (like a cat). Then, round your back, tucking your chin to your chest and your tailbone towards the floor (like a cow).
